<?php
/*
Handle all media processing for content. Used for publish module and for base OpenGraph data.
This is an annoying and complex set of rules and functions and interdependancies.
You have been warned.
*/
// main OpenGraph handler
add_filter('sfc_base_meta','sfc_media_handler', 10, 2);
function sfc_media_handler($og, $post) {
// only add this sort of meta to single post pages
if (!is_singular()) return $og;
$options = get_option('sfc_options');
// first we apply the filters to the content, just in case they're using shortcodes or oembed to display stuff
$content = apply_filters('the_content', $post->post_content);
// video handling
$vids = sfc_media_find_video($post, $content);
if ( !empty($vids) )
$og = array_merge($og,$vids);
// image handling
$images = sfc_media_find_images($post, $content);
if (!empty($images)) {
foreach ($images as $image) {
$og['og:image'][] = $image;
}
} else if (!empty($options['default_image'])) {
$og['og:image'][] = $options['default_image'];
}
// audio handling
$auds = sfc_media_find_audio($post, $content);
$og = array_merge($og,$auds);
if (isset($og['og:audio'])) {
// audio files on posts sometimes get misidentified as video, clear those out
unset($og['og:video']);
unset($og['og:video:height']);
unset($og['og:video:width']);
unset($og['og:video:type']);
}
return $og;
}
function sfc_media_find_images($post, $content='') {
if (empty($content)) $content = apply_filters('the_content', $post->post_content);
$images = array();
// we get the post thumbnail, put it first in the image list
if ( current_theme_supports('post-thumbnails') && has_post_thumbnail($post->ID) ) {
$thumbid = get_post_thumbnail_id($post->ID);
$att = wp_get_attachment_image_src($thumbid, 'full');
if (!empty($att[0])) {
$images[] = $att[0];
}
}
if (is_attachment() && preg_match('!^image/!', get_post_mime_type( $post ))) {
$images[] = wp_get_attachment_url($post->ID);
}
// now search for images in the content itself
if ( preg_match_all('/<img\s+(.+?)>/i', $content, $matches) ) {
foreach($matches[1] as $match) {
foreach ( wp_kses_hair($match, array('http')) as $attr)
$img[strtolower($attr['name'])] = $attr['value'];
if ( isset($img['src']) ) {
if ( !isset( $img['class'] ) || ( isset( $img['class'] ) && false === straipos( $img['class'], apply_filters( 'sfc_img_exclude', array( 'wp-smiley' ) ) ) ) ) { // ignore smilies
if ( !in_array( $img['src'], $images )
&& strpos( $img['src'], 'fbcdn.net' ) === false // exclude any images on facebook's CDN
&& strpos( $img['src'], '/plugins/' ) === false // exclude any images put in from plugin dirs
) {
$images[] = $img['src'];
}
}
}
}
}
return $images;
}

/*
Quick documentation for hackers who want to screw around with this:
For Facebook to properly use video information, all four video fields *and* the image must be populated.
So if you're going to try to do some url magic, then you may need to make an API call somewhere to get the
image for the video thumbnail (or other things, conceivably). If you do, then setting the $save=true like I
did above will make the below line of code save your results in post meta and then they won't have to be
re-retrieved from whatever API you're hitting. There's a call up at the top to handle retreiving those
meta results and using them, thus bypassing all the parsing nonsense.
But, ONLY set $save to true if you're making external API calls. If you can get the image info without making
an external hit, then leave it false so as to not waste space in the DB with the meta information. Notice how
I don't save the YouTube info because it's not necessary. In actual fact, that image isn't the exact same as
the one they use on their data, and I could make an oEmbed API call to get their image, but it's pointless
since that image URL I'm generating always works anyway.
*/
